The car is never released due issues of tire physics we have at the moment and it has been planned to release after tire physics are ready.

But, over 9 years, tire physics are still not ready due even more issues.

Due strange glitches by driving LX6 here, layout is now received an update. So if you have downloaded .lyt file BEFORE of this edit of post, please download again.

Changes: Although layout is now slightly smoother, the "holes" which did cause some weird movements by tire getting through the "hole" and causing to lose control, is now fixed and happens much, much less frequently. You will still have a chance to lose control due uneven and bumpy layout.
